    On Aug 23, 2004, at 3:34 PM, Doug Ewell wrote:

    > Deborah Goldsmith <goldsmit at apple dot com> wrote:
    >
    >> FYI, by far the largest source of text in NFD (decomposed) form in
    >> Mac OS X is the file system. File names are stored this way (for
    >> historical reasons), so anything copied from a file name is in (a
    >> slightly altered form of) NFD.
    >
    > "Slightly altered"?
    >

    Yes, the specification for the Mac file system was frozen before NFD
    had been developed by the UTC, so it isn't exactly the same. But it's
    close.
